What are the Steps Involved in Performing Deep Palpation?

1. Preparation: Ensure the patient is in a comfortable position, usually lying supine with knees slightly bent to relax the abdominal muscles.
2. Warm-Up: Warm your hands to avoid causing discomfort.
3. Systematic Approach: Use a systematic approach by dividing the area into quadrants or sections.
4. Technique: Apply firm, steady pressure using the fingertips or the palmar surface of the fingers. Gradually increase the pressure to reach deeper structures.
5. Observation: Observe the patient's facial expressions and listen for any indications of discomfort or pain.
6. Documentation: Record findings accurately, noting any tenderness, masses, or abnormal consistency.
